Hooky is heading back to his ancestral home of Ordsall to chat about, well, everything at Salford Lads' Club on Saturday 15th October. It's an extra date for Substance: An Evening with Peter Hook, which sold out immediately for the night at The Albert Square Chop House.
Hooky will be in-conversation with Dianne Bourne, from the Manchester Evening News, who suggested that he write a book about his life and times. Now, with two brilliant best sellers behind him documenting the Hacienda and Joy Division, and the third expose, Substance: Inside New Order, about to be unleashed, the night should be gripping, to say the least.
"This in-conversation event will be a rare opportunity to hear Pete talk openly to an audience in an intimate setting" state the organisers "He is a keen supporter of Salford Lads' Club, having grown up in the area, and continues to lend his support to the club's development."
After the interview, there will be a chance for the audience to ask Hooky questions themselves, and signed copies of Substance will be available to buy on the night.
